本文主要讲解最大流问题的Ford-Fulkerson解法.可以说这是一种方法,而不是算法,因为它包含具有不同运行时间的几种实现.该方法依赖于三种重要思想:残留网络,增广路径和割. 在介绍着三种概念之前,我们先简单介绍下Ford-Fulkerson方法的基本思想.首先需要了解的是Ford-Fulkerson是一种迭代的方法.开始时,对所有的u,v属于V,f(u,v)=0(这里f(u,v)代表u到v的边当前流量),即初始状态时流的值为0.在每次迭代中,可以通过寻找一个“增广路径”来增加流值.增广路径…